Unveiling the Geometric Interpretation of Complex Numbers

Complex numbers, often perceived as abstract entities, possess a fascinating spatial interpretation. Beyond their algebraic representation as a+bi, where 'i' is the imaginary unit, complex numbers can be depicted as points in a two-dimensional plane known as the complex plane. The real part of a complex number corresponds to its x- coordinate, while the imaginary part correlates to its y- coordinate. This correspondence unveils a elegant connection between arithmetic operations on complex numbers and visual transformations in the complex plane.

Exploring the Applications of Complex Numbers in Engineering

Complex numbers, entities often regarded as esoteric mathematical curiosities, play a pivotal role in myriad engineering disciplines. Their ability to represent variables with both real and imaginary components enables engineers to simulate phenomena that defy traditional real-number analysis. Uses range from circuit design and power systems to control theory and signal manipulation. The inherent sophistication of complex numbers allows engineers to tackle challenges that would be intractable using only real-number mathematics.

  • For instance, in electrical engineering, complex impedances effectively model the behavior of components containing both resistive and reactive elements.
  • Furthermore, complex Fourier transforms provide a powerful tool for decomposing signals, enabling engineers to identify specific frequency components.

Exploring the Plane of Complex Numbers: Visualization and Representation

Unveiling the secrets of the complex plane necessitates a shift in our traditional perception of numbers. Where real numbers reside on a single axis, complex numbers expand this domain into two dimensions. Each complex number is represented as a point across this plane, its coordinates reflecting the real and imaginary components. This visual representation empowers us to grasp the properties of complex numbers in a dynamic manner.

  • Visualizing add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division of complex numbers becomes accessible through geometric transformations on this plane.
  • Additionally, the concept of magnitude and argument can be easily observed from the point's location compared to the origin.
  • Therefore, the complex plane provides a valuable framework for understanding and manipulating complex numbers, serving as a crucial tool in diverse fields such as electrical engineering, signal processing, and quantum mechanics.
